软件如何防止盗版
随着科技的发展,软件盗版问题日益严重。如何有效地防止软件盗版,保障软件开发商的合法权益,成为了许多企业和用户关注的焦点。小编将围绕这一问题,从多个角度为您解析如何防止软件盗版。
一、加密技术
1.采用高强度加密算法:通过对软件进行加密,使得破解者难以获取软件的源代码和运行机制,从而降低盗版风险。
2.数字签名:为软件添加数字签名,确保软件的完整性和安全性,一旦发现篡改,即可追溯源头。
二、授权机制
1.激活码:通过激活码验证用户的购买资格,防止盗版用户使用软件。
2.限时授权:设置软件的使用期限,到期后需重新购买授权,减少盗版行为。
三、版权声明
1.在软件界面、帮助文档等位置明确显示版权信息,提高用户对盗版的认识。
2.在软件安装、运行过程中,提示用户尊重知识产权,不支持盗版。
四、反破解技术
1.采用动态链接库技术,使得软件的运行依赖于特定的环境,降低破解成功率。
2.添加防篡改模块,一旦检测到软件被修改,立即停止运行。
五、用户教育
1.开展知识产权宣传活动,提高用户对盗版危害的认识。
2.引导用户购买正版软件,支持正版,共同打击盗版。
六、技术支持
1.提供在线客服、技术支持等服务,解决用户在使用正版软件过程中遇到的问题。
2.及时更新软件,修复漏洞,提高软件安全性。
七、法律手段
1.加强与执法部门的合作,打击盗版软件的生产、销售和传播。
2.对盗版者进行法律追究,维护软件开发商的合法权益。
八、行业协会
1.成立行业协会,加强行业自律,共同打击盗版行为。
2.定期举办知识产权培训,提高企业对盗版的防范意识。
九、技术创新
1.研发新型授权技术,提高软件的安全性。
2.探索人工智能、区块链等技术在软件版权保护领域的应用。
十、市场策略
1.提供多样化的购买渠道,满足不同用户的需求。
2.举办促销活动,降低正版软件的价格,鼓励用户购买正版。
十一、持续关注
1.关注行业动态,了解盗版技术的发展趋势。
2.不断优化软件版权保护措施,确保软件开发商的合法权益。
防止软件盗版是一个系统工程,需要从技术、法律、市场等多个角度入手,共同努力,才能有效遏制盗版行为,保护软件开发商的合法权益。
- 上一篇:电脑硬盘有什么功能吗